Role Title: Project Manager (Supplemental Work)

Manager: Head of Supplemental Work

Manager-once-Removed: Vice President—Asset Management

The purpose of this position is to provide effective project management to ensure successful delivery of a range of Keolis Commuter Services (KCS) supplemental work projects in line with quality, safety, cost, and time targets.

Key Accountabilities:

1. To develop robust project plans covering the full life cycle of the project to ensure delivery of project in line with quality, cost, and time objectives.

2. To establish costs, resources, accurate timelines to develop business cases and Project Initiation documents.

3. Coordinate cost estimating, budgeting, and monitoring and control for construction projects and support services.

4. Effective construction and management of project budgets.

5. Effective and timely recovery of all project costs to ensure KCS margin targets.

6. Represent KCS-Engineering at construction, track outages, site inspections, as well as payment and payment documentation meetings with the MBTA.

7. Lead procurement and tendering of project to ensure risk of project delivery and cost are balanced.

8. Manage project effectively from initiation to completion.

9. Effective negotiation and management of the contract with the Supply chain.

10. Assess, mitigate and manage all project risks, dealing effectively with issues that arise.

11. Develop specifications for subcontractor scopes of services.

12. Responsible for detailed design scrutiny, ensuring that the chosen designs support the reliability, availability, ability to be maintained and safety requirements of the System while ensuring compliance with all industry and mandatory standards.

13. Report and communicate effectively, facilitating timely decision making and progress through milestones.

14. Ensure safety and quality assurance that appropriate mandatory, MBTA and KCS standards are being delivered both internally by KCS staff and externally by KCS suppliers.
